Teneurin-1(also Ten-m1, tenascin-M1, and Ten-m/Odz1) is a 250-300kD member of the tenascin family, teneurin subfamily of transmembrane (TM) molecules. It is a covalently-linked homodimer that is expressed in both embryonic and adult neurons, among which are cerebellar granule cells and CA2 pyramidal hippocampal neurons. Teneurin-1 appears to promote neurite outgrowth and mediate cell-to-cell adhesion via homophilic interactions. Human teneurin-1 is a 2725aa type II TM glycoprotein. It contains a 324aa cytoplasmic region (aa1-324) that contains an NLS (aa62-65), plus a 2380aa extracellular domain (ECD). The ECD possesses eight sequential EGF-like domains (aa528-796), five NHL repeats, each of which form a b-propeller (aa1194-1524), and 23 YD/TyrAsp-containing repeats that bind carbohydrates. Cleavage at the N-terminus generates an initial 65kD membrane-spanning fragment, followed by TM cleavage that generates a 45kD cytosolic fragment. C-terminal cleavage generates a short 5kD 41aa peptide (aa2682-2722) termed TCAP-1 that shows bioactivity. One splice variant shows a deletion of (aa1232-1239).
